Panasonic had six patents in mobile during Q4 2023. Panasonic Holdings Corp filed patents related to uplink control information mapping in NR technology for wireless communication methods and a system for executing transactions using a distributed ledger. The first patent focuses on mapping Uplink Control Information to physical resources in a user equipment for transmission to a base station. The second patent describes an authentication server storing transaction data in a distributed ledger and executing programs to facilitate transfers between user accounts based on available balances. Application: User equipment, base station and wireless communication method (Patent ID: US20230422267A1)

The patent filed by Panasonic Holdings Corp. pertains to user equipment, base station, and wireless communication methods related to uplink control information mapping in NR. The user equipment includes circuitry to map Uplink Control Information (UCI) to available resource elements based on their distances from reference signal elements in time, frequency, and spatial domains. The transmitter then sends the UCI and reference signals in Physical Uplink Shared Channel (PUSCH) to the base station.

The patent claims detail an integrated circuit and communication apparatus for controlling the reception and demodulation of HARQ-ACK bits, Channel State Information (CSI) bits, and data in PUSCH using CP-OFDM in 14 OFDM symbols. The HARQ-ACK bits are mapped to specific OFDM symbols and resource elements, while DMRSs are mapped to assigned subcarriers. The communication method involves receiving and demodulating the HARQ-ACK bits, with specific mappings for HARQ-ACK bits, DMRSs, and CSI bits within the 14 OFDM symbols. The patent focuses on optimizing the mapping of uplink control information in NR for efficient wireless communication.
